A tradition that spans generations. Cedar chests — often called hope chests, dowry chests, or trousseau chests — were once used by young women to gather linens, clothing, and meaningful household pieces for the life ahead. Lined with naturally aromat...

From the golden age of travel, these historic trunks once crossed oceans and continents by ship, train, and carriage. Built to endure long journeys, many now live quieter lives as storage pieces or statement décor — each one carrying a sense of adven...
Vintage Steamer Trunks (Late 1800s–1920s)
Some of the most famous trunks in history came from travel houses like Louis Vuitton, whose flat-topped trunks helped define luxury travel in the late 19th century. Today, whether vintage or newly crafted, these pieces still carry that sense of journ...
